Voltage Compatibility
One of the most critical rules is matching your power supply voltage to your LED strips. For example, a 24V strip powered by a 12V supply will not work, while a 12V strip connected to a 24V source may burn out components instantly.
Always double-check the labels on your hardware before making any connections. Using a streamlined LED controller can help you simplify your lighting management and ensure everything stays within the correct voltage range.
Current Rating Considerations
Beyond voltage, you must consider the current rating, often measured in Amps. Your power supply must provide enough current to handle the total load of your lighting system.
- Calculate the total wattage of your strips.
- Ensure your power supply has a 20% buffer for safety.
- Avoid overloading a single power source to prevent flickering or dimming.

Misjudging Length Requirements

One of the most common pitfalls in home lighting projects is miscalculating the total length of your LED strips. Precision is vital to ensure your space looks balanced and professional. Following these Tips for successful LED strip placement will help you avoid uneven lighting or wasted materials.
How to Calculate Strip Length
Before you begin, measure your installation area carefully. If you are using 12V strips, remember that you must inject power every 5 meters to prevent voltage drop. This simple step ensures that the brightness remains consistent from the start to the very end of your run.
Ignoring these technical limits is one of the Key errors in LED strip placement that often leads to dimming. We recommend mapping out your power points before you secure the strips to the surface.

Avoiding Cuts in the Wrong Places
Always check for the designated cut marks printed on your LED strips. Cutting outside these lines can damage the internal circuitry and cause entire sections to fail. Always take your time to verify the location before making any adjustments to the length.
| Strip Type | Max Run Length | Power Injection | Best Use Case |
|---|---|---|---|
| 12V Standard | 5 Meters | Required at 5m | Accent Lighting |
| 24V High Output | 10 Meters | Required at 10m | Task Lighting |
| Constant Current | 15 Meters | Not Required | Large Spaces |

Distinguishing Between Wattage Needs
Calculating the total power consumption of your strips is a vital step in the process. You should always sum up the wattage of all connected strips and then add at least 20–30% extra capacity to your power supply. This essential headroom prevents the transformer from overdriving, which significantly extends the lifespan of your LEDs.
By maintaining this buffer, you ensure that your system remains cool and stable during long hours of operation. Importance of Proper Ventilation
LEDs are highly efficient, but they still generate heat during operation. If this heat remains trapped, it can degrade the internal electronics and cause the light output to dim over time. One of the key errors in LED strip placement is mounting strips in enclosed, unventilated spaces where heat has nowhere to go.
Ensuring adequate airflow is essential for maintaining the integrity of your setup. Whether you are working with ceiling tile lights or accent strips, always allow for natural convection. This simple step prevents overheating and keeps your system running smoothly for years.
Using Aluminum Channels
The most effective way to manage temperature is by using aluminum extrusion channels. These profiles act as a highly efficient heat sink, drawing heat away from the LED diodes and dissipating it into the surrounding air.
